Default Mwc 9

Category: Drivetrain
Price: $2450
Part Fits: 93-02 Chevrolet Camaro, 93-02 Pontiac Firebird
Location (State): NY
Item Condition: Used
LS Engine?: Fits LS Engine

https://ls1tech.com/forums/album.php...ictureid=64006
https://ls1tech.com/forums/album.php...ictureid=64005

MWC 9, 4.11, spool 35 spline, T-56 DriveShaft, rear coated in por 15. Torque arm with DS loop built in. 67 miles on it come and pick it up. Save 500 over what I paid and no 3 month wait. I will sell without DS but wont break the rear down.

Comes as pictured, backing plates are backwards, e-brake has modied bracket that bolts to rear. The rear was not touched.

Buying a chevelle so the car is being parted out.
